REPAIR OPERATION
Applicator disconnection
Remove the Ultrasound connector from the device, the
advice “Applicator disconnected (0x00000000)” is
displayed.
Check Pass/Fail the tracker sheet §4 if “Applicator
disconnected (0x00000000)” is displayed.
Resumption of the Ultrasound program
Put back the Left Ultrasound connector into the device.
Switch the G16 Test Load ULTRASOUND to
“UNCOUPLED”.
Or
The applicator must be in air or in the holder
Press Resume
Select the field intensity and increase again with the
knob until 2.0 W/Cm2.
Set the G16 Test Load switch ULTRASOUND to
“COUPLED”
Or
Put the end of the transducer in water.
Check Pass/Fail the tracker sheet §5, if the program is
resumed.
Total patient leakage
Connect a red banana cable to the red connector IN (MD
box). After, connect it to the black connector of STIM
CH1 (G16 Test Load).
Connect the banana connector of the “Banana wall plug”
to the black connector IN (MD box). After, connect the
wall plug to the wall. If you have a ground banana
connection on the table you can use it, using a yellow
banana cable.
Set the multimeter to V DC and V AC, then read the
values after stabilization. Finally Press “Pause” button.
Value of V DC Value of V AC
Check Pass/Fail the tracker sheet §6 , if the values are
less than the reference
Remove the red banana cable. First on the G16 Test
Load, then on the MD Box.
